    Selling this gold engraved gat is GunBroker seller Fords Custom Guns, located in Crystal River Florida.  Let’s see what they had to say about these heavy modifications made to this Colt:

    This is a Colt Government model, 70 Series, chambered in .38 Super with a 5″ National Match barrel. The firearm is new, unfired, with original box, paperwork, grips, and one mag.

    This gun has been laser engraved with an Aztec theme and plated in 24k Gold. All engraving and plating were performed by Ford’s Custom Plating.
